I'm trying to get a dual-tuner system going.
Everything works if I have either the PVR 350 or the
150 in the box by themselves. But if I put in the
second card, the 350 works fine and the 150 appears to
be recognized by ivtv, but captures from it are empty
files.
The 350 is recognized first.
The system is running FC3, built based upon the
Myth(ology) howto. Here are my modprobe.conf and log
messages.
